At last the prince gave in and the pixie went away with the statue.
The prince was sad indeed. He sat alone at twilight and sang:
“O princess dear, O princess dear,
I am sad in the fall of the year.
I should be happy, it is plain,
If you would come back to me again.”
The prince’s heart gave a crack. It almost broke in two.
An autumn leaf floated in through the window. On it was written:
“The princess dear will come again.
